5 practical tips to know if your car battery is dead or not: check it out!

Okay, so your car won't start and the problem is probably with the battery. Below are 5 tips to help you determine if it's faulty.

1. Battery discharging

A very common sign is when your battery is frequently discharging, as this is a warning that its lifespan is coming to an end. Or, if it's a new battery under warranty, it's probably defective and you should request a replacement.

2. Battery with a strong odor or leaking.

Another factor that can indicate if the battery is damaged is if it is emitting a strong odor, or even leaking water. If this happens, it's a sign that it's overheating. Therefore, it's more than time to replace it with a new one.

3. Verdigris at the poles

Another symptom that indicates a weak battery is if the terminals are covered in corrosion. And what is corrosion? Corrosion is that greenish residue that accumulates on the terminals over time.

This hinders the flow of electric current and prevents it from functioning properly. Therefore, if this is the reason, have it cleaned. You can find several tips online on how to clean it correctly.

4. The engine turns slowly or doesn't turn at all.

Well, when trying to start the car, the engine turns slowly or doesn't start at all. This is another indicator that your vehicle's battery doesn't have enough charge. Therefore, its lifespan may be ending because it's not charging properly. So, to avoid being stranded, it's a good idea to replace it.

5. Manufacturing date

Car batteries typically don't have a defined expiration date, but they do have a limited lifespan. Therefore, check the manufacturing date on the top of your car battery, as they generally last around two years. Some last a little longer. In any case, if that period has already passed, it may be time to retire your battery and replace it with a new one.

So, these are some of the symptoms that batteries exhibit, indicating that at some point they will let you down.

Furthermore, malfunctions can cause problems for both the alternator and the electrical components of your car. But before you go out and buy another one, it's a good idea to test it to determine its actual condition. Therefore, find an authorized dealer and request one.

Through this test, the voltage being supplied and the battery's charge level are measured. It's also possible to verify if, when starting the car, the necessary voltage is maintained to start it. Thus, with these tests, it will be possible to identify if it's really time to replace the battery.

Furthermore, if you trust the dealer, you can ask for their opinion regarding the actual need for the replacement, thus avoiding unnecessary costs. Also, request a test of the alternator, as the problem may be with this component.

Useful tips to prevent battery damage.

Well, every car owner probably already knows that batteries are sensitive to cold. This is because the chemical reaction that produces electrical energy becomes more difficult to carry out in low temperatures. That's where the problem arises, but it doesn't mean the batteries are faulty.

Also, avoid leaving electrical equipment plugged in while the car's engine is off, as this can cause a greater electrical discharge. Additionally, it's good to avoid leaving the vehicle parked in the garage for extended periods. Therefore, even if you're not going to leave the house, it's best to regularly start the engine for a while.
